A person of mass m stands at the edge of a circular platform of radius R and moment of inertia. A platform is at rest initially. But the platform rotate when the person jumps off from the platform tangentially with velocity u with respect to platfrom. Determine the angular velocity of the platform.

Let the angular velocity of platform is `omega`. Then the velocity of person with respect to ground v.
`v_(mD)= v_(mG) - V_(DG)`
` u = v_(m) + omega R`
`v_(m) = u - omega R `
Now from angular momentum conservation
`L_(i) = L_(f)`
` 0 = mv_(m) R - I omega `
`rArr I omega = m (u - omega R) . R `
` rArr omega = (m u R)/(l + mR^(2))`
